Topographical Factors Influencing Defensive Strength and Vulnerability
Topographical factors significantly influence the defensive strength and vulnerability of mountain top positions. The elevation, slope, and terrain features determine the natural advantages available to defenders and the challenges faced by attacking forces.
Steep slopes enhance defensibility by limiting easy access and forcing enemies into exposed approaches. Conversely, gentle slopes or flat areas increase vulnerability, allowing easier movement and potential infiltration. The terrain’s ruggedness can also impede mobility for both sides.
Natural features such as ridges, cliffs, and valleys shape tactical considerations. Ridges offer commanding views and fire support, while valleys can act as choke points or areas of concealment. Recognizing these features allows for optimal placement of defensive assets.
Understanding these topographical factors is essential for selecting strong positions and developing effective defensive strategies. Proper assessment minimizes vulnerabilities and maximizes the natural advantages of mountain top locations.

Historical Case Studies of Successful Mountain Top Defense Strategies
Historical case studies demonstrate the strategic significance of mountain top defense positions in military history. For instance, during the Battle of the Caucasus in World War II, Soviet forces utilized rugged mountain peaks to establish resilient defensive lines against advancing German troops. Their knowledge of terrain and natural fortifications contributed significantly to delaying and weakening enemy advances.
Similarly, the Battle of Thermopylae, although not solely a mountain top position, exemplifies the tactical advantage of high ground. The Spartans and their allies utilized narrow mountain passageways as a defensive position against the Persians, leveraging natural terrain as a force multiplier. This historical example highlights how terrain can shape defensive success when properly exploited.
These case studies underscore that effective use of natural features and strategic positioning on mountain tops has repeatedly proven crucial in military history. Such examples continue to inform modern tactics related to the importance of mountain top defensive positions in contemporary warfare.
Modern Technologies Enhancing Mountain Top Defensive Positions
Modern technologies substantially improve the effectiveness of mountain top defensive positions by providing advanced surveillance, communication, and targeting capabilities. Unmanned aerial vehicles (UAVs) or drones enable real-time reconnaissance, offering precise observation of enemy movements and terrain conditions. This enhances situational awareness and reduces risks to personnel.
Satellite imagery and geospatial analysis tools further contribute by mapping terrain features with high accuracy, assisting strategic placement of defenses. These technologies enable military units to identify vulnerabilities and adapt their positions accordingly, maximizing defensive strength while minimizing exposure.
Integration of advanced sensor networks, including acoustic and seismic sensors, enhances early detection of enemy activity. These systems can be discreetly deployed, providing continuous monitoring without revealing defensive positions. Such technological integration is essential for maintaining the security of mountain top defenses amid evolving threats.
